NearStack 100 for Edge Computing

Direct-to-Cable Connector System for Maximizing System Performance

In real-time processing of edge computing, it is essential to minimize data transmission delays and enhance system responsiveness. In particular, the fast and stable transmission of sensor data and control signals is crucial for real-time decision-making and execution. Transmission loss and noise can lead to processing delays and malfunctions, potentially affecting the overall performance of the system. Our OCP-compliant NearStack 100 Ohm connector addresses these challenges by providing a direct-to-cable connector system compatible with Molex's BiPass I/O in a compact package. 【Use Cases】 - High-speed data communication between edge devices - Building real-time control systems - High-density wiring within data centers 【Benefits of Implementation】 - Improved overall system response speed - Ensured stability of data transmission - Increased flexibility in equipment placement due to space-saving design

basic information

【Features】 - Supports applications requiring 100-ohm impedance - Compatible with 34 AWG Twinax cables - Built with a modular wafer/bay structure 【Our Strengths】 Lester Corporation is an information platform that broadly supports electronics manufacturing, from handling semiconductors and electronic components to system solutions.
